Hey dude. I suffered from this problem all through the campaign on my first attempt. I was running the game at 1080P on the 360 on a 1080p Plasma tv. I reduced the 360 resolution down to 720P and it seems to have fixed this problem. I've done 5 levels on my second playthrough with no grain/banding issues and it feels smoother to play. Just something for you to try. There patching the game this week, so hopefully they'll fix this problem but in the meantime, run it at 720P.

For some odd reason, when I play the game off the disk, and not install, I don't get the line issue. But when I play on an installed game, the lines come and go. I tested the opening level and the power out level and found this was the case. Perhaps this is their way of copy protecting to prevent piracy. Either way, I hope it is fixed. I like to install games to keep my 360 running quiet and less wear and tear on the hardware. It worked for me, try it out and see if you get similar results. See you online!
